match mac access-group
Configure a match criterion for a class map, based on the contents of the designated MAC ACL.
Syntax
match mac access-group {mac-acl-name}
Parameters
mac-acl-name
Enter a MAC ACL name. Its contents is used as the match criteria in the class map.
Defaults none
Command Modes CLASS-MAP
Supported Modes FullSwitch
Command
History
Version Description
9.9(0.0) Introduced on the FN IOM.
8.3.16.1 Introduced on the MXL 10/40GbE Switch IO Module.
Usage
Information
To access this command, enter the class-map command. After the class map is identified, you can
configure the match criteria.
Related
Commands
class-map identifies the class map.
match mac dot1p
Configure a match criterion for a class map based on a dot1p value.
Syntax
match mac dot1p {dot1p-list}
Parameters
dot1p-list
Enter a dot1p value. The range is from 0 to 7.
Defaults none
Command Modes CLASS-MAP
Supported Modes FullSwitch
Command
History
Version Description
9.9(0.0) Introduced on the FN IOM.
8.3.16.1 Introduced on the MXL 10/40GbE Switch IO Module.
Usage
Information
To access this command, enter the class-map command. After the class map is identified, you can
configure the match criteria.
Related
Commands
class-map identifies the class map.
match mac vlan
Configure a match criterion for a class map based on VLAN ID.
Syntax
match mac vlan number
Parameters
number
Enter the VLAN ID. The range is from 1 to 4094.
Defaults none
Command Modes CLASS-MAP
Supported Modes FullSwitch
